From 0090ca18cec642f4ec0a57ff36380789a3f704b5 Mon Sep 17 00:00:00 2001 From: daz Date: Thu, 27 Jun 2024 17:16:59 -0600 Subject: [PATCH] Ignore test on older Gradle versions --- .../MultiProjectDependencyExtractorTest.groovy |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/plugin-test/src/test/groovy/org/gradle/github/dependencygraph/MultiProjectDependencyExtractorTest.groovy b/plugin-test/src/test/groovy/org/gradle/github/dependencygraph/MultiProjectDependencyExtractorTest.groovy index 0a16c2c..cb6f0e3 100644 --- a/plugin-test/src/test/groovy/org/gradle/github/dependencygraph/MultiProjectDependencyExtractorTest.groovy +++ b/plugin-test/src/test/groovy/org/gradle/github/dependencygraph/MultiProjectDependencyExtractorTest.groovy @@ -2,6 +2,8 @@ package org.gradle.github.dependencygraph import org.gradle.test.fixtures.maven.MavenModule +import org.gradle.util.GradleVersion +import spock.lang.IgnoreIf class MultiProjectDependencyExtractorTest extends BaseExtractorTest { private MavenModule foo @@ -251,6 +253,10 @@ class MultiProjectDependencyExtractorTest extends BaseExtractorTest { ]) } + @IgnoreIf({ + // `includeBuild('.')` is not possible with Gradle < 6.1 + GradleVersion.version(testGradleVersion) < GradleVersion.version("6.1") + }) def "extracts dependencies from build that includes itself"() { given: settingsFile << """